The Niagara Falls Marathon was first run in 1974. Starting in the USA and finishing in Canada, it is the only marathon to start and finish in different countries. The marathon is accompnaied by the Niagara Falls Half Marathon race, marathon relay and 10K and 5K.

Niagara Falls Marathon Route
The Niagara Falls International Marathon course is a point-to-point race from Albright-Knox Art Gallery in Buffalo N.Y. to Niagara Falls in Canada. The first 4 miles goes along the amazingly scenic parkways of Buffalo. Runners then cross the Peace Bridge, from USA into Canada, through the historic old town of Fort Erie and along the stunning Niagara River Parkway, finishing at the outstanding Niagara Falls.

The route is mainly flat, being overall downhill with a 2 mile downhill section at the end of the race. For this reason ot is a good race for PBs.
